Hair Quality

Hair Strand

The hair was bought in a 14’’ length and was bought in the color natural black. The color was unified from root to tip giving a hint that the hair was truly virgin. Even the baby hairs were rich in color making the pre plucked hairline a plus. 

The body wave gave a beautiful bounce to the hair, the hair was textured down to even the very ends of the hair. When brushed out you could see they instantly revered to the body wave. 

The hair was soft which led to the hair being frizz free and easy to detangle. This is a big benefit because it means the hair is likely to last longer.

Hairline

This unit came equipped with a frontal, the frontal was 13x 4 and made from swiss lace. Unfortunately this was part of the downfalls to the unit as the lace was so thin it showed the strands excessively.

Swiss lace is known to be thin and blend in with many skin tones, while this is the case the knots tend to be more prominent. You would need some customization to make it look natural.

The density could have also played a part in this, they added more strands of hair to make the unit thick but in turn make the hairline look unnatural.

Density

The best part of the wig was definitely the density. You could tell right away the high density. While the hair was purchased in the highest density possible, It didn’t seem too heavy.

While the hair is only 14’’ in length, the density doesn’t seem to overwhelm the look. The hair would fall right below your shoulder without looking too blunt or thick.

The site offered two other options for density, all under 200%. This could be an added benefit for anyone who decides to purchase the hair in a longer length.

Construction

The unit had a few excess strings but many parts of the hair had double stitching to secure the unit. This is of benefit because it means it’s likely to have a longer longevity as less likely to fall apart.

The lace was made from a good material that blended well with the rest of the unit. Since lace can be the most fragile part of a wig, having one that is well constructed is a good thing to look for.

All of the wefts were evenly sewn on and the combs felt secure as well. Having these already constructed onto the wig is an added benefit because it means less customization for the installer.

Cap Size

The lace frontal takes up about half of the area of the cap. The back half of the cap is equipped with two elastic straps, 4 clips, and an additional thick strap that can be applied or removed to your liking. 

The cap itself was very stretchy. This is desired since it allows for the wig to mold to your head and lay flatter. 

The cap came in the size average. It can even be easily customized as it comes with an extra strap to secure the unit. You can make it smaller in seconds meaning it will work for most, as long as you can fit it on your head in the first place.

Range of Products

The company provides a wide range of products. From wigs in a variety of styles and bundle sets. These sets come complete with either a closure or frontal. Both of these units come in a variety of different sizes as well.

The hair comes in 4 different hair types; Brazilian, Peruvian, Malaysian, and Indian. In both wigs and bundles these types are available. They are also available in over 8 different textures.

Tinashe hair is a part of many companies that provide HD lace wigs. This lace is ultra thin and transparent all the while sturdy. The hair is pre-pluck and has single knots that allows the hair to have seamless blending even at a distance of 2 feet.

Delivery Time

The company ships the hair within 24 hours of the order and uses the services DHL and FedEx to process shipping orders. I received the package within 4 business days.

Most counties take 3-5 business days to process while others take 4-7 days. Some things to note are P.O boxes are not accepted as deliverable addresses. While looking over reviews It was difficult to find any that had a negative experience with shipping.

While the delivery was on point, the packaging for this hair was below average. The free gift came in a silk bag and the unit in a plastic zippable bag, this being the case everything arrived without harm.

FAQ

How long does Tinashe hair last? 

Due to the fact that the hair is 100% human hair, the product can last for 6-12 months. If you take the proper care, human hair wigs from Tinashe hair can last up to 2 years. Their lace front wigs are also known to last longer.

Does Tinashe hair part their wigs?

All of the brand’s lace wigs are part free except for the middle part for bob wigs. This means the hair can be changed from a middle to side part freely. Due to its stagninate status during transport, the part may seem permanent but can be changed.

Does Tinashe hair hold heat styles well?

The company claims yes but there are some helpful tips you can follow. Use the correct temperature and hold for 8-10 seconds. Hair spray helps and it’s beneficial to try out a test strand.

Where does Tinahse hair come from?

The hair is manufactured in China and they supply to multiple different sources. The hair is 100% virgin human hair which means it comes from one donor.
